‌MES数智汇
文章7167 浏览56365

MES系统需求文档,如何编写完整的MES系统需求说明?

在制造业数字化转型的浪潮中,MES系统作为连接计划层与执行层的核心工具,其需求文档的编写质量直接影响项目成败。我曾参与多个千万级MES项目实施,发现70%的失败案例源于需求模糊或遗漏关键点。本文将结合十年实战经验,从架构设计到细节把控,系统讲解如何编写一份专业、完整、可落地的MES需求文档。

一、MES需求文档的核心架构设计

编写MES需求文档如同建造一座智能工厂,需要先搭建稳固的框架再填充细节。我曾主导某汽车零部件企业的MES项目,因初期未明确设备联网协议标准,导致后期集成成本增加30%。这让我深刻认识到,系统架构设计是需求文档的基石。

1、功能模块划分

MES系统通常包含生产调度、质量管理、设备监控、物料追溯等八大核心模块。建议采用"基础功能+行业定制"模式,如电子行业需强化SMT贴片管理,汽配行业要重点设计防错防漏功能。

2、数据流设计

数据是MES系统的血液。需明确从ERP接收生产订单,到设备采集数据,最终反馈至统计报表的完整闭环。某家电企业通过优化数据流设计,使生产异常响应速度提升40%。

3、集成接口规划

要预先规划与ERP、PLM、SCADA等系统的对接方式。推荐采用RESTful API接口标准,某项目通过统一接口规范,将系统集成周期从3个月缩短至45天。

二、需求描述的黄金法则

精准的需求描述是避免项目扯皮的关键。我曾见证两个团队因"实时监控"定义不同产生纠纷:技术团队理解为1秒刷新,业务部门期望是5秒。这警示我们,需求描述必须量化可验证。

1、5W1H描述法

每个需求点都要回答What(功能)、Why(业务价值)、Who(使用角色)、When(触发条件)、Where(应用场景)、How(操作方式)。如:"质检员在完成首件检验后(When),通过PDA扫描工单号(How),系统自动比对检验标准(What),超差时立即触发警报(Why)"。

2、业务规则量化

将"快速响应"转化为"异常发生后2分钟内推送至责任人移动端",把"提高效率"具体为"单位产品工时从12分钟降至9分钟"。某项目通过量化规则,使需求验收通过率提升65%。

3、非功能性需求

要明确系统响应时间(建议生产操作界面≤2秒)、数据精度(如温度采集误差≤±0.5℃)、兼容性要求(支持Windows10/Linux双平台)等关键指标。

三、需求验证与优化技巧

再完美的文档也需要实践检验。我曾采用"原型验证法",在某食品企业用低代码平台快速搭建核心功能原型,通过两周的现场测试,修正了23处流程设计缺陷。这种方法比传统文档评审效率提升3倍。

1、用户参与式验证

组织跨部门工作坊,让生产、质量、IT人员共同操作原型系统。某项目通过这种形式,发现并解决了17个部门间流程冲突点。

2、需求追溯矩阵

建立需求项与测试用例的对应关系,确保每个需求都有验证方法。推荐使用Excel或JIRA工具管理,某企业通过此方法将需求遗漏率降至2%以下。

3、变更管理流程

设定需求变更的评估机制,重大变更需经过CTO、生产总监双签。某项目通过严格变更控制,避免范围蔓延导致成本超支18%。

四、相关问题

1、MES需求文档需要包含哪些必须要素?

答:必须包含系统目标、功能模块清单、数据流图、接口规范、非功能性需求、验收标准六大要素。建议采用"总-分-总"结构,先概述系统定位,再分章节详细描述,最后明确验收方式。

2、如何平衡业务部门的个性化需求?

答:采用"80%标准化+20%定制化"策略。将通用功能如工单管理、数据采集做成标准模块,对特殊工艺要求开发插件式功能。某机械企业通过这种模式,既满足个性化需求,又将实施周期缩短40%。

3、编写需求文档时容易忽略哪些细节?

答:最常见的是忽略异常处理流程,如网络中断时的数据缓存机制;其次是忽视用户权限设计,导致操作越权;还有忽略多语言支持需求,这在跨国企业实施中尤为重要。

4、有没有推荐的需求文档编写工具?

答:专业MES厂商豪森智源提供的HS-MES需求模板非常完善,包含200+个标准需求项。开源工具如Confluence+Draw.io组合也能高效完成文档编写和流程图绘制。

五、总结

编写MES需求文档犹如绘制智能工厂的蓝图,既要高瞻远瞩规划架构,又要脚踏实地雕琢细节。记住"三要三不要"原则:要量化描述不要模糊表述,要流程闭环不要断点设计,要用户参与不要闭门造车。正如建筑大师贝聿铭所说:"细节成就完美",一份优秀的需求文档正是通过0.1毫米级的精度要求,铸就数字化转型的坚实基石。